Misty Windows

Double glazing is an excellent investment for your home. It will save you money on energy bills, help keep the inside of your home safe and comfortable and also improve its appearance. However, it can get damaged or discolored with time. This could be due to the weather or cleaning chemicals. Or, it could be caused by a break in the seal between two panes of glass. This can cause windows to become fogged up or mist.

This issue can be solved. Many Glaziers will repair the sealed unit inside the window, instead of replacing the entire frame and glass. They can also be able to install new frames if required. But the most important factor in preventing windows from becoming misty is to avoid using chemical cleaners or harsh cleaning products. These chemicals can cause damage to the insulating seal, which can cause moisture to seep into the glass.

A Glazier will be able to identify the cause of your window problem and recommend the best solution. Before they can give you a quote, they will probably need to conduct a survey. They will have to measure your frames and windows to find the right replacement seals.

After the survey is completed, the glazier will be able to replace the frame and window with the correct materials. The glazier will inspect the windows and make sure that they are functioning properly. This includes monitoring the temperature in your home.

If your windows are misting it is essential to get them fixed as soon as possible. This will prevent damp and mould from forming within your home, which can be harmful to your health and the structure of your house. A damp or mouldy home can cause respiratory issues, allergies, and auto-immune conditions. Getting your windows replaced as soon as possible will reduce the risk of these problems, and also ensure that your blown double glazing repair near me-glazed windows are functioning to its maximum potential.

Broken Windows

Most windows in the present are double-glazed, and consist of two or more glass panes that are separated by a space and sealed around the edges to keep humidity out. Also called IGUs or insulated glass units (IGU) They're efficient in reducing energy consumption and are also more secure than single pane windows, which are broken easily by vandalism or burglary. When a window gets broken it's essential to call a company that specialises in replacement double-glazed units near me in order to ensure your home is secured and protected from the elements of nature as well as pests and potential damage to your property.

When the seal between the two glass panes in a window breaks, outside air can get into your home. This increases your heating and electric bills. This can cause the temperature inside your home to decrease, which can be uncomfortable for you and your family.

A faulty sealed unit may cause condensation between your window panes that is not just ugly, but could also lead to other problems in your home.

It can be very expensive to repair rotten wooden frames caused by excessive moisture. Mildew and mold can be a problem for your family as well as you. They can affect your immune systems.

You can test to determine if the seal between the glass panes of a window is broken as they are almost invisibly. One method is to shine a torch through the window and look for reflections of light off the surface of the glass. If you can see the torchlight, then the seal is good and your windows are working exactly as they should. Another test is to look at the uPVC or aluminium frame and check for cracks or gaps where heat can escape. If you find cracks or gaps, it's time for a replacement double-glazed unit.

Condensation inside

If you notice condensation on the inside of your double-glazed windows, it's not necessarily a sign that they're defective and not performing as they ought to. It could be an indicator that there is excessive moisture in the air, or there isn't enough air flow within the room or building. This is typically the case if you've recently hired builders or other tradesmen in working on your property, as wet plaster, cement and paint release a lot of moisture.

The solution is to open the window slightly or make use of an extractor fan, leaving the window open during the night can also help. Alternatively, Replacement Double Glazed Units Near Me try to create more shade around the windows and doors as this will decrease the amount of water emitted by direct sunlight.

Condensation appearing between your windows could be the result of a fault with the 'spacer' between your windows. It is the space between two panes of glass. It also contains an insulating material that can absorb any moisture or water. If the spacer is damaged it will soon become saturated and the excess moisture will appear as condensation.

A problem with the sealant may also be the cause of the condensation that forms between the window panes. This is more likely to happen if the windows were installed by a reputable firm that offers an insurance backed guarantee as it ensures that the work will be done for a specific number of years.

To repair the sealant between double-glazed windows you will need to remove the unit. This is a difficult job and is not something to be attempted without proper training or experience because it is likely that you'll damage the glass or cause further damage. However it is possible to get the unit repaired in a cost-effective way by companies that specialize in this type of work. They typically drill one or two holes into the pane of glass or in the spacer bars. They then pump or inject the sealed unit with a drying agent or anti-fogging agent.

Security Problems

If your windows appear slightly cloudy or misted up, it's most likely due to the insulating properties of double glazing aren't performing as they should. A broken or misty window can allow heat to escape from your home and cause structural problems such as damp and mould. Replacing broken double glazing with new units is a cost-effective and quick project that can dramatically improve the appearance of your home as well as to reduce energy consumption.

If a double-glazed window is showing signs of deterioration, it's an ideal idea to replace all glass panes of the window with new insulated glass units. It may be tempting to only replace the damaged or misted pane. However, this could harm the seals that surround the other glass panels of the insulated unit. This can cause moisture to leak into your home. A professional installer will inspect the other glass panes in your insulated unit for water condensation and leakage that cannot be seen with the naked eye.

Replacement IG units are modern units that offer significantly more efficient thermal performance than the older single- or double-glazed windows. The new units are designed to be slim and fit into existing frames, which means you don't have to worry about altering the appearance of your house. The modern materials and insulation technologies used make them more energy-efficient.

Modern IG units are made of an outer layer of glass with low-emissivity and an inner pane of float that is clear and a space between them that is filled with air or inert gas like argon or krypton. The gas inerts slow down the heat transfer, which helps to keep your home warm.

Installing containment-grade glazing in one or more panes of your new windows will also give you extra security. The material is extremely durable and is able to withstand a significant amount of force. It can even withstand bullets that could shatter other types of glass.
